Output e4ea6289a098171cc4c99e0feeccc5e0339bc7ab9b8a14c22e451f8295030aa9:7

value
24164374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ea857909ee39e88e1bd74050cd2a18d0ebb53d4a OP_EQUAL
address
3P53wHW8XghqkJHRud5Sfe9ZuerxgWGWHY
transaction
e4ea6289a098171cc4c99e0feeccc5e0339bc7ab9b8a14c22e451f8295030aa9
spent
true